Pepper Steak - cooking recipe

Ingredients
    1 1/2 lb. beef round steak, 1/2-inch thick
    1 Tbsp. shortening
    1 (6 oz.) can tomato sauce
    1/2 medium onion, thinly sliced
    1/2 tsp. garlic salt
    2 tsp. Worcestershire sauce
    2 tsp. beef-flavored gravy base
    1/4 tsp. salt
    2 bell peppers, cut in 1/3-inch strips
Preparation
    Trim fat from steak; cut meat into 2 x 1/4-inch strips.
    Brown in hot shortening, drain.
    Add tomato sauce, onion slices, garlic salt, beef-flavored base, Worcestershire sauce, salt and dash of pepper to browned meat.
    Cover tightly and simmer over low heat for 50 minutes.
    Stir in green pepper.
    Cook, covered, until pepper is tender (6 to 8 minutes).
    Serve over rice.
